Lake County, Oregon reported 353 farm operations in the 2022 USDA Census of Agriculture, generating $175.7M in total commodity sales and receiving $5.4M in federal farm program payments. Intensity stamp MID ($7.00/acre); land stamp PASTURE-LED. Net cash farm income came in at $57.0M. In-state sales rank #10 of 36 in Oregon.
Of 765,761 acres agricultural land, cropland is only 153,269 acres (20.0%) - a PASTURE-LED mix where livestock forage and disaster titles (LFP/ELAP) usually outweigh row-crop commodity programs. | Category | Acres | Share of Ag Land |
|---|---|---|
| Total agricultural land | 765,761 | 100.0% |
| Cropland | 153,269 | 20.0% |
| Pasture, range, woodland, other | 612,492 | 80.0% |
| Average farm size | 2,169 | acres / farm |
